Wingapalooza 2018 is back for the fourth straight year, taking place 11 a.m. to 3 p.m. Saturday, Aug. 4 on the main floor of INTRUST Bank Arena in downtown Wichita. The arena and SMG host this all-you-can-eat wing fling that attracts as many as 2,000 attendees trying a smorgasbord of wings from some of our favorite Wichita restaurants while introducing new flavors and chefs.

Here are five things to know about this year’s Wingapalooza:

It’s all-you-can-eat wings

Participating restaurants and chefs are supplied with wings – more than 40,000 total – that they can season and cook in any manner to showcase their culinary skills. You’ll find saucy, dry, hot, sweet and flavors you never considered! You’ll receive a bottle of water with your wing tray when you enter, then you can walk booth-to-booth to try a variety of wings or settle on a favorite and eat until you’re full. There are vegetables and dipping sauces, too, and there’s also a beer garden, beverage concessions and an in-house DJ providing music.

Enjoy returning favorite vendors and new faces, too

Organizers are still working on signing up several new vendors this year, and as we publish this blog post we can confirm Chisholm’s American Beef and Ale House, the new restaurant at the DoubleTree by Hilton Wichita Airport, is participating for the first time. Among the other vendors: BJ's Restaurant & Brewhouse, Pizza Hut Wingstreet, Rib CribRiver City Brewing Co., SAVOR… Wichita, Slim Chickens, The Keg Sports Bar and Grill, Twin Peaks (Westand East) and Wingstop.

Wingapalooza schedule

Doors open for regular ticket holders at 11 a.m. and the wing eating begins! The event ends at 3 p.m., and the presentation of the People’s Choice Award dubbed “Lord of the Wings” and a Judge’s Choice Award is at 2:15 p.m.

Buy tickets in advance to save money

Ticket prices are $20 in advance or $25 at the door; the event is capped at 2,000 attendees. Organizers recommend buying in advance online at selectaseat.com, by phone at 855-755-SEAT or in person at the Select-A-Seat Box Office at INTRUST Bank Arena. You can also buy a commemorative T-shirts in advance when you purchase online.

New VIP option available

If you want to get a 15-minute start on digging into the wings, there’s a new VIP ticket available this year. For $30, you get early entry and one drink ticket.
